On , Eurovision Song Contest’s grand final took place at Liverpool’s M&S Bank Arena where 26 acts and bands from across the world participated. Tens of millions of viewers across the globe tuned in to watch the biggest music competition and to see which act would be crowned the champion of Eurovision Song Contest 2023.

The competition was held in Liverpool this year on behalf of Ukraine, as they were unable to host due to the Russian invasion. The event started with a skit that featured last year’s winners Kalush Orchestra, followed by a performance from 26 musicians who performed their hearts out to win the coveted trophy.

However, a minor confusion occurred when singer Brunette, who was representing Armenia in this year’s contest, appeared on the stage. The viewers were distracted as they mistook her for American singer Ariana Grande. They took to their Twitter accounts to express their opinion, with some saying that Ariana Grande had invaded the show.

One of the Twitter users who posted about the confusion said “For a second I thought Ariana was at #Eurovision Armenia’s entry looked good tho.” Another user posted, “ARIANA WHAT ARE YOU DOING HERE?! #Eurovision.”

Despite the confusion, Brunette was able to deliver a smashing performance of her song Future Lover. Her performance managed to win many hearts, even though the viewers first thought it was Ariana Grande performing for Armenia.
